The Incident Leading to Bryce Drummond’s Arrest
In May 2024, Bryce Drummond, 22 years old at the time, was arrested in Stillwater, Oklahoma, on suspicion of driving while intoxicated (DWI). The incident began when local law enforcement responded to a report from neighbors who alleged that a group of men were engaging in reckless behavior, including drinking, attempting to start fights, and driving dangerously around the neighborhood.
Upon arrival, an officer observed a group of men quickly entering a nearby home. After waiting in the area for about an hour, the officer noticed the lights of a Ford pickup truck turn on. Approaching the vehicle, the officer identified Bryce as the driver. According to court documents, Bryce exhibited multiple signs of intoxication, leading the officer to conclude that he was in actual physical control of a motor vehicle while under the influence of alcohol.
Legal Proceedings and License Revocation
Following the arrest, Bryce faced misdemeanor charges related to the DWI incident. However, in April 2025, a judge dismissed the misdemeanor charge against him. Despite this dismissal, Service Oklahoma, the state agency responsible for driver licensing, pursued civil action that resulted in the revocation of Bryce’s driver’s license for 180 days.
Bryce subsequently filed an appeal in an attempt to overturn the license suspension. Unfortunately for him, the Oklahoma Court of Civil Appeals upheld the revocation, confirming that Bryce would remain without driving privileges for the designated period.
